what is the scope for a BHMS doctor for government employment
Hello Aspirant,
Hope you are doing good. BHMS doctors do have scope for government employment.
There are posts of medical officer in Government Homeopathic Hospitals, ESI dispensaries and primary health centers and CCHRH centers, as also tutor in Government Homoeopathic Medical colleges. However, vacancies are much less compared to the number of candidates and hence the competition is really tough.

I want to work in USA because my spouse in doing jobe as Engineer. Being Indian can I have sufficient opportunity for employment in USA.
Hi, it is not a myth that getting an VISA to USA is difficult. With the complexity of the procedure you have different options to which you can apply for. You can apply for H4 Visa the down side to it is that you are not allowed to work there. H4 dependent Visa is for the one's whose spouse are already in the USA or have an H1B Visa. Job opportunities for you to apply directly is going to be very difficult and not impossible. It is a long route and a tedious one. Hope this helps.

Bsc. in forensic science Vs B.pharma which will be better in terms of employment ?
Hello Rya,
Hope you are doing well.
Forensic is obviously a good course but Pharmacy is a better choice. Career opportunities of Forensic are less as compared to Pharmacy. Pharmacy has a lot of career options. You can join various medical companies and different job opportunities are available in Pharmaceutical industries like in production, quality check etc. Otherwise, both are very good choice. Forensic in undoubtedly very interesting. It is all about crime and mystery. On the other hand, Pharmacy is regarding health issues.
